UK Tax Agency Recorded the Voices of 5.1 Million Brits

The UK’s tax agency has collected the voice records of over 5.1 million Brits, a privacy group has discovered. The HMRC collected these voice records via a new service it launched in January 2017. The service allows UK citizens to authenticate when calling HMRC call centers via their voice. The only way to avoid creating a voice track was by saying “no”” three times during the voice track creation process
